अध्याय ५०: उत्तरेण सह अर्जुनस्य रथप्रयाणे ध्वजचिह्नैः कौरवसेनानिर्देशः
Arjuna directs Uttara by identifying Kaurava commanders through banners
अधीत्य ब्राह्मणो वेदान् याजयेत यजेत वा | क्षत्रियो धनुराश्रित्य यजेच्चैव न याजयेत्
adhītya brāhmaṇo vedān yājayet yajeta vā | kṣatriyo dhanur āśritya yajec caiva na yājayet ||
Dijo Kṛpa: «Tras estudiar los Vedas, el brāhmaṇa debe celebrar sacrificios por sí mismo o bien oficiar y conducir los sacrificios de otros. El kṣatriya, apoyado en el arco—esto es, en el deber marcial y la protección—debe celebrar sacrificios para sí, pero no debe actuar como sacerdote conduciendo sacrificios ajenos, pues ese oficio pertenece a los brāhmaṇas.»
कृप उवाच
The verse distinguishes duties by varṇa: a brāhmaṇa, grounded in Vedic study, may perform sacrifices and also officiate for others; a kṣatriya should perform sacrifices for himself but should not assume the priestly role of conducting rites for others.
Kṛpa states a normative rule about proper social and ritual conduct, emphasizing that priestly officiation (yājana) is the domain of brāhmaṇas, while kṣatriyas should adhere to their martial vocation symbolized by reliance on the bow.
